Welcome aboard; context: the Quillgate validation framework loads third-party validator plugins at startup. When a plugin's init hook throws, the loader silently skips it, so downstream pipelines run with fewer checks than configured and nobody notices. Expected: startup should fail loudly with the plugin name and error. Please reproduce with the sample malformed plugin in the fixtures directory, then add a regression test. When filing your fix, paste the failing run's trace token below.

pipeline stamp: htk31_f769b577b3028a4e9958e5bb8d1259a

Note for incoming contractors on the Fennwick integration: our webhook provider, Larkspur Relay, retries failed deliveries five times with exponential backoff, starting at 30 seconds and capping at one hour. After the fifth failure, events move to a dead-letter queue and require manual replay. Idempotency keys are mandatory on our side. Questions about replay access or retry tuning should go to the vendor liaison.

escalation mailbox, yajeg-bageg: quenax.olidor@lumiccorp.internal

### Account Recovery — Catalogue Import (Lintwood)

Quick one for review: when the Lintwood catalogue import wipes a patron's session table, the recovery flow re-seeds accounts from the nightly snapshot. Check that the importer skips locked accounts — last time it didn't. To rerun recovery against staging you'll need the vault passphrase, which is appended just below.

recovery phrase for yafof-tajof: julmir-kelax-julvan-holath-belvan-holir-ralael-ralvan-ralath-julvan-silmir-istmir-kaswyn-ulamir

## Account Recovery — Trailnote Offline Mode

When a surveyor's Trailnote app has been offline for 30+ days, their local credentials expire and sync refuses to resume. Don't make them wipe the device — all their unsynced field data lives there! Instead, open the support console, pick "Offline Reinstate," and enter their handle. The console will ask for the support team's shared recovery passphrase before issuing a reinstatement token. Use the one below.

unlock words, bagaf-fajeg: zorael-kelax-fraath-quenix-eliok-sileth-aldmir-wenir-druiel